Position Overview:
We are seeking an experienced Data Architect to be included in a new team focused on the development of the company's DWH. In this context s/he should analyze, design and manage robust data architectures that support our advanced analytics and business intelligence solutions.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of data modeling, ETL processes, reporting, data-mesh and, in general, cloud-based data platforms.
Key Responsibilities:
Design and implement scalable data architectures to support business analytics and reporting needs.
Develop and maintain data models, schemas, and data pipelines.
Collaborate with data engineers and stakeholders to optimize data pipelines and ETL processes.
Ensure data quality, integrity, and security across all data systems.
Evaluate and integrate new data technologies and tools to enhance our data infrastructure.
Provide guidance and best practices for data management and governance.
Work closely with cross-functional teams to understand business requirements and translate them into technical specifications.
Monitor and optimize database performance to ensure efficient data retrieval and processing.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field.
5+ years of experience in data architecture, data modeling, and database design.
Strong expertise in SQL, python, spark.
Experience with cloud-based data platforms, in particular Microsoft Azure.
Proficiency in ETL tools, orchestration, data integration technologies.
Solid understanding of data warehousing and data processing technologies.
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
Strong communication and interpersonal skills to work eff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Preferred Skills:
Experience with data governance and data quality frameworks.
Strong knowledge of data visualization tools like Tableau or Power BI.
